How to download free downloadable books to read on Kindle legally?

5 Answers2025-07-01 03:03:59
I've explored many legal ways to download free books. The best method is through public domain sites like Project Gutenberg (gutenberg.org), which offers thousands of classic books formatted for Kindle. You can download EPUB or MOBI files and email them to your Kindle address. Another great option is your local library. If you have a library card, apps like Libby or OverDrive let you borrow e-books legally and send them directly to your Kindle. The selection varies, but it’s a fantastic way to read bestsellers for free. Just make sure to return them on time! Amazon also has a 'Kindle FreeTime' section with rotating free books, though they’re often lesser-known titles. Lastly, some authors and publishers offer free Kindle editions as promotions—check sites like BookBub or Freebooksy for deals.

Which free book download site supports legal audiobook downloads?

5 Answers2026-07-15 23:37:44
Apple Podcasts has a ton of serialized fiction podcasts that are full-length novels. Since they're distributed via RSS, they're free to subscribe to and download. Shows like 'The Magnus Archives' (audio drama) or 'LeVar Burton Reads' (short stories) offer professional-grade audio storytelling. For traditional novel formats, search terms like 'audiobook serial' or 'full cast audiobook'. Many indie authors are using this model to build an audience. It's 100% legal, and downloading through your podcast app is the intended method. The discovery is the hardest part, but once you find a creator you like, you can often download their entire back catalog.
